Blue Roses Porcelain Nail Art (Jelly polish)

I am so digging jelly polishes these days!! But they are hard to find by where I stay and I am on a mission to make some. Recently after Revlon launched some new polishes here I saw Revlon's Royal, a blue jelly polish. I suspected I had something very similar in my stash of untrieds.


OPI's Dating a royal. Its a jelly finish leaning towards creme. 2 coats make it almost opaque.
Now I suspect this is really close to Revlon Royal.
I stamped with BM 323 with the bold roses design
Stamping polish: Konad silver and konad white for accent.
The accent really looked like those white-blue chinese porcelain.
Topped with SV


Usually I am not a fan of rosey designs but this one was good. They stamped perfectly and the jelly polish does give it a floating effect, like you see a layer below the stamping.
